Congrats on your MPP! If you're sticking with the MPP, I see no real advantage with the R/E goggles other than looking a bit cooler and having red leather padding. There "may" be a bit better range with the additional screw-in Pagoda antenna, but the R/E goggles seem to be more affected by WiFi in the city. So, I recommend just buying the standard DJI Goggles.
